How much do online unreal engine developer j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 20, 2026, the average hourly pay for online unreal engine developer in the United States is $38.44,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$32.69 and $42.79 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an online Unreal Engine developer do?

An Online Unreal Engine Developer specializes in creating, integrating, and optimizing multiplayer and networked features within games or applications using Unreal Engine. They work on building server-client architectures, implementing online gameplay systems, and ensuring smooth, synchronized experiences for players across the internet. Their responsibilities also include troubleshooting network issues, optimizing performance, and collaborating with designers and other developers to bring interactive online features to life. These roles are crucial for developing modern multiplayer games and applications that rely on robust online connectivity.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an online Unreal Engine developer?

To thrive as an Online Unreal Engine Developer, you need expertise in C++ programming, a deep understanding of Unreal Engine's architecture, and a background in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with source control systems (like Git), multiplayer frameworks, and experience with Unreal Engine's networking tools are typically required. Strong problem-solving abilities, effective communication, and a collaborative mindset help developers excel in remote or distributed team environments. These skills ensure the creation of robust, scalable online experiences and efficient teamwork in the fast-evolving game development industry.

What are some common challenges online Unreal Engine developers face when collaborating remotely with multidisciplinary teams?

Online Unreal Engine Developers often work closely with artists, designers, and other programmers, which can present challenges in communication and project coordination when working remotely. Aligning on version control, asset integration, and real-time problem-solving may require additional tools and disciplined workflows. Regular virtual meetings and clear documentation are essential to keep everyone on the same page and ensure smooth collaboration. Building strong communication habits and being proactive in addressing technical or creative blockers can help developers thrive in a remote, multidisciplinary environment.

What is the difference between Online Unreal Engine Developer vs Game Programmer?

AspectOnline Unreal Engine DeveloperGame Programmer
Required SkillsUnreal Engine, C++, Blueprint, online multiplayerProgramming languages, game logic, engine integration
Work EnvironmentRemote or studio, focus on online featuresStudio or remote, broader game development
Industry UsageGame development, VR/AR, online platformsGame studios, indie developers, tech companies

Online Unreal Engine Developers specialize in creating online multiplayer features using Unreal Engine, often requiring knowledge of C++ and Blueprint. Game Programmers have a broader focus on coding game mechanics across various engines. While both roles involve programming skills, Online Unreal Engine Developers focus more on online functionalities within Unreal Engine, making their roles distinct in online game development projects.
